How to Edit Audio Files

Editing Audio Files

If you are on a PC, we recommend software called Audacity:

http://audacity.sourceforge.net/

This is a free download.

Audacity will allow you to edit and modify your audio files. You can even stitch in bumper music or apply fades and other effects.

To modifying your audios:

  1. Download your MP3 file from PubClip to your computer
  2. Edit the MP3 using Audacity to cut out portions you don't want or add other files
  3. Save the changes to a new file
  4. Upload the new audio file to PubClip
